Darren Barker beat Geale to win the world title last night.Really enjoyable fight and Barker was down in the sixth but did well to beat the count and clung on in the round.He fully deserved the win and he took the fight to Geale in the closing rounds.Always thought Macklin should have fought Geale for the title instead of Golovkin but I don't think Geale wanted the fight.
Kiko Martinez also won a world title last night ,the flurry of punches he threw in the 6yh to win it was class.hopefully Frampton gets a shot at him. Edited by rossieman - 18 Aug 2013 at 12:50pm |
